In our first video, we show you how we cut and installed 2x4 flooring in our shop bathroom for less than $80. Our total investment was about 6 hours of labor including cutting the 2x4s, organizing them, installing, sanding, and applying the polyurethane. Our space was a little over 6' by 7' or 42 square feet. This is a great, cheap DIY option for where imperfection is perfection (like in a workshop!)
